Houston Jury Awards $4,174.95 for Negligence in Rear-End Collision
One driver stopped at a traffic signal when the other driver rear-ended their vehicle. The first driver claimed the second driver was negligent. The second driver denied negligence and claimed the first driver was not seriously injured. The jury found the second driver negligent.

About Neck Injury (Whiplash) Injuries
Whiplash is a neck injury caused by rapid back-and-forth movement of the head, commonly occurring in rear-end collisions. Despite being frequently dismissed, whiplash can cause significant pain and disability.

Case Overview
A plaintiff filed a negligence lawsuit following a rear-end collision that occurred on March 24, 2014, in Houston, TX. The incident took place as the plaintiff was lawfully stopped at a traffic signal on Fairmount Parkway when the defendant, also traveling westbound, struck the rear of the plaintiff's vehicle. The plaintiff alleged the defendant was negligent for failing to maintain a proper distance, keep an adequate lookout, and control vehicle speed. Following the accident, the plaintiff sought treatment for neck and back pain, receiving diagnoses that included cervicalgia, lumbago, cervical radiculopathy, headaches, and bilateral shoulder strain and sprain.
The defendant denied all allegations of negligence and disputed that the plaintiff's injuries were serious or permanent results of the collision. After deliberation, a jury found the defendant negligent and awarded the plaintiff $4,174.95 for past medical expenses.
